lycans are part of an elaborate communication system vital for cellular recognition, cell-cell interactions, protein transport, immune defense, and more. These three-dimensional sugar structures attached to most proteins encode a vast amount of information that researchers are just beginning to tap (See “Getting Your Sugar Fix,” The Scientist, April 2015). “With glycans, there are several levels of information,” says Carlito Lebrilla, a chemist at the University of California, Davis: the number of protein positions carrying a glycan, the location of each of those glycosites, and the chemical composition and branching structure of each glycan. Despite being the most common posttranslational modification, the complexity of glycosylation has left glycobiology lagging behind other fields, such as protein sequence analysis and genomics. But that’s changing as researchers identify glycosylation as an important player in many diseases, including cancer.
